Historically, Costco has usually not disclosed the producers of the Kirkland branded spirits; a practice that has given rise to incessant speculation among consumers about whose liquid is actually in the bottle. According to the website Tequila Taste Matchmaker, all three of Kirkland's tequilas (Anejo, Silver, and Reposado) currently trace back to La Madrilea inTototlan, a city in the Mexican central-western state of Jalisco. However, the tequilas were previously produced by La Madrilea (NOM 1142) and Fabrica de Tequilas Finos (NOM 1472) before ending up with their current distiller. The price makes it drinkable lol.
